Transaction 42cba6dd3795532fe86e78339cf769e06cfbe86243cf65694d28071ca25c4543
1 Input
1 Output
-
42cba6dd3795532fe86e78339cf769e06cfbe86243cf65694d28071ca25c4543:0
- value
- 594024
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faaad972edccdee68f299d4c392025b65381b86
- address
- bc1qe742m9ewmnx7u68jn82v8ysztdjnsxuxzgl357